WebNov 16, 2024 · A specific magnetizing inductance and a gapped-core construction are needed in a flyback, allowing the transformer to store high levels of energy without going into saturation. A forward-mode transformer has high primary magnetizing inductance to support efficient energy transfer between the windings. WebDec 13, 2024 · Most power electronics engineers would say that a typical ferrite flyback transformer needs a gap. This is because a flyback transformer is a " store & release " converter - i.e. it stores energy in the gap ( and a teeny bit in the core ) and then releases the stored energy to the output at turn off. WebNov 26, 2004 · The five most common topologies for transformer-isolated smps are : the two single-ended, flyback & simple forward, and the three symmetrical, push-pull center-tap, half-bridge, and full-bridge. The single-ended circuits must have air gaps in the transformer core in order to prevent core saturation. Since the cores are driven in one direction ...
